Bouillon over past Habs hurt
Francis Bouillon doesn't want to linger on why the Habs let him get away last time. He's more focused on this latest "next time".
The veteran defenseman heading into his 3rd tour of duty with Les Canadiens speaks with CJAD 800's Barry Morgan in a 1-on-1 interview about his re-signing on a 1-year deal at the age of 36.
Bouillon admits it hurt to leave the Habs for 3 seasons in Nashville.
